About Washington, D.C.

Washington, D.C., is a city where historic architecture, cultural landmarks, and vibrant neighborhoods coexist within a dense urban environment. As the capital of the United States, the city is home to iconic locations such as the White House, the United States Capitol, and the National Mall. The district's streets are filled with museums, monuments, and government buildings that attract millions of visitors each year. At the same time, local residents enjoy a mix of historic rowhouses, modern apartments, and established communities that give the city its distinctive character.

Life in Washington, D.C. blends fast-paced professional activity with a strong cultural atmosphere. Many residents work in government, public service, law, education, or the nonprofit sector, creating a community that values progress and civic engagement. Neighborhood markets, cafes, and restaurants offer an incredible variety of cuisines, reflecting the city's international population. Popular dishes such as half-smokes from local eateries and diverse global cuisine showcase the district’s rich culinary culture.


The city also hosts a wide range of public events and seasonal attractions. Festivals, outdoor concerts, and cultural celebrations occur throughout the year across parks and public spaces. During spring, the National Cherry Blossom Festival transforms the city into one of the most photographed destinations in the country. Residents also enjoy waterfront areas, public gardens, and historic neighborhoods. Washington, D.C., combines historic significance with modern urban living, creating a dynamic environment where millions of people live, work, and explore every day.

Climate & Environmental Factors in Washington, D.C.

Washington, D.C., experiences a humid subtropical climate characterized by warm summers, mild to cool winters, and noticeable seasonal transitions. Summers are typically hot and humid, with temperatures frequently rising into the high eighties or nineties. High humidity, combined with periodic rainfall, creates ideal conditions for many insect species to thrive and reproduce rapidly. Winters are generally milder compared to northern states, but occasional cold spells and snowfall still occur. Spring and fall provide moderate temperatures, yet the changing seasons often trigger shifts in insect activity as pests search for food, moisture, and shelter.


These environmental conditions make bug control an ongoing concern for many property owners in Washington, D.C. Warm temperatures and humidity accelerate the breeding cycles of common pests such as ants, cockroaches, and spiders. Moist environments inside crawl spaces, basements, or poorly ventilated areas can further encourage infestations. During colder months, insects often move indoors in search of warmth and protection, increasing the likelihood of household infestations. Because the city has dense housing and numerous interconnected buildings, pests can easily travel between structures if infestations are not properly addressed.


Urban infrastructure and older construction styles can also contribute to pest activity. Many historic buildings contain small gaps, aging materials, and hidden structural spaces that provide easy entry points for insects. Tree-lined streets, underground utility systems, and shared building walls create additional pathways for pests to migrate from one location to another. Without professional bug control, these environmental factors allow infestations to spread quickly. Effective pest management strategies must therefore address both the climate conditions and structural characteristics common throughout Washington, D.C.

Urban Pest Challenges in Washington, D.C.


Residents and business owners in Washington, D.C., often face persistent pest problems due to the city’s dense population and aging infrastructure. Multi-unit buildings, restaurants, offices, and residential properties all provide environments where insects can easily locate food, moisture, and shelter. Once pests gain access to a structure, they can quickly spread through wall voids, basements, and shared plumbing systems. Cockroaches, ants, and spiders are particularly common concerns in urban buildings, where kitchens, trash areas, and hidden spaces provide ideal conditions for them to thrive.


The age and construction style of many buildings in the district can contribute to these issues. Historic rowhouses and older commercial properties may contain cracks, foundation gaps, and aging materials that create entry points for insects. Even modern buildings can develop pest issues when ventilation systems, crawl spaces, or storage areas retain moisture. Additionally, high-density neighborhoods mean that a single infestation can affect multiple units within a building if not treated correctly. These structural conditions make professional bug control essential for long-term pest management.
